confium-wasm
Browser / Node.js verifier package for Confium. WASM-bindgen surface, verifier-only by design.
Design principle: browsers verify, servers sign. This crate exposes only the operations that a browser-side consumer needs to validate signatures, certificates, CMS envelopes, composite signatures, and transparency proofs. Signing, threshold session participation, and PKCS#11/OpenSSL provider dispatch all stay server-side — they have no place in a browser context.
What's inside
| Module | What it verifies |
|---|---|
| CompositeSignature | PQ-migration composite signatures (Ed25519 + future ML-DSA-65). |
| MerkleTree, InclusionProof | RFC 6962 transparency log proofs. |
| Predicate | Attribute-based threshold policy DSL. |
Usage (from JS/TS)
import init, { CompositeSignature, verify_ed25519 } from "@confium/confium-wasm";
await init();
const sig = CompositeSignature.from_json(jsonString);
const ok = sig.verify(messageBytes); // -> { all_verified: bool, per_component: [...] }Crate features
Each verify-* feature gates a verifier subtree so consumers can
tree-shake. All are on by default for out-of-the-box ergonomics.
| Feature | Gates |
|---|---|
| verify-composite | CompositeSignature |
| verify-transparency | MerkleTree, InclusionProof |
| verify-attributes | Predicate |
Building
wasm-pack build crates/confium-wasm --target web --release --scope confiumOutput lands in crates/confium-wasm/pkg/, ready for npm publish as
@confium/confium-wasm.
